Transaction 3440e41ce9862ddc7bcc1cf56bdf74863882adcabc6abd7c64f2804215e4a2f6

1 Input
2 Outputs
  • 3440e41ce9862ddc7bcc1cf56bdf74863882adcabc6abd7c64f2804215e4a2f6:0
  • value  30000000
    address  3HNpVBYSV1vAdgPVhMMyb1kWZ9uxYFAMFb
  • 3440e41ce9862ddc7bcc1cf56bdf74863882adcabc6abd7c64f2804215e4a2f6:1
  • value  90918782
    address  1P4HxEkfhjrczQpStoCXenPn3pFS7nFJJn